CONSTRUCTION INDUSTRY COUNCIL 140 OPERATIONAL REVIEW Recognition from 2024 HKMA Quality Award C-SECT coordinated the CIC’s participation in the 2024 HKMA Quality Award. The CIC was awarded the Excellence Award for demonstrating organisational excellence in total quality management, contributing to the sustainable success of the construction industry in Hong Kong. With the achievement of this prestigious award, the CIC remains committed to upholding the highest standards of quality and continuously improving CIC services. Improving Stakeholder Relationship The Stakeholder Relationship Management System was revamped to further optimise the management of appointment records of various entities under the CIC, providing a more holistic view of appointment records and facilitating more efficient reporting. The improved system has significantly enhanced CIC’s ability to manage stakeholder relationships effectively. Three MFV visits to various CIC premises or facilities were held in 2024 covering the HKIC Sheung Shui Campus (SSC), the CIC-Zero Carbon Park together with the Construction Innovation and Technology Application Centre, and the HKIC Kowloon Bay Campus (KBC). The valuable improvement suggestions made by the visiting groups helped to enhance the operation of various departments or business units and also contributed to strengthening the governance and service quality of the CIC. Four CIC Fellows Sharing sessions were conducted on HKIC campuses in 2024. The sharing sessions aimed to provide HKIC students with the opportunity to learn from the experiences and insights of the CIC Fellows who have made significant contributions to the construction industry. The first sharing session was conducted at KBC with Ms. Eliza WONG as the guest speaker, followed by sharing sessions conducted at SSC with Ir CHAN Chi-chiu and Ir Rocky POON respectively, and at KBC with Sr YU Kam-hung. The CIC Fellows would continue to contribute to the holistic development of HKIC students through such sessions. In addition, in the Annual Event of the CIC Follows, the CIC Fellows enjoyed the sharing from tech ventures in the Hong Kong Science & Technology Parks (HKSTP) and a guided tour to another tech venture located in HKSTP.
